Carrying The Torch For Chatham-Kent

Shannon Prince is excited to be named torch bearer for Chatham-Kent's leg of the relay, leading up to this year's Pan Am Games in Toronto.

The curator of the Buxton National Historic Site & Museum says the decision was made by the Chatham-Kent Chamber of Commerce and she was shocked, but honoured. "To be a part of that experience, for me, it's going to be very memorable and emotional."

The Pan Am Torch will pass through Chatham on June 16.

The games start July 10 and last until July 26.
